#7c6b16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c6b16 is composed of 48.6% red, 42%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 82.3%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 50 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 28.6%. #7c6b16 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8d62c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#7c6b16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c6b16 has RGB values of R:124, G:107,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.82,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8153878.

Shades and Tints of #7c6b16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070601 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f6 is the lightest one.
